Prod and staging have drifted. Staging handlers use the tuned pre-warm pool; prod still runs the old defaults, so cold starts on the invoice handlers spike past acceptable latency every morning. Someone hand-edited staging months ago and never backported. For new folks: all handler settings must come from the repo, never the console — console edits are how we got here. Plan: reconcile prod to match the reviewed staging values, then lock console writes. The intended canonical configuration follows.

deployment values, bagag-bawig:
DRUVAN_PIN=0740
DRUVAN_TENANT=wendor
DRUVAN_METRICS_HOST=metrics.druvan.tolvaqnet.example
DRUVAN_SEAL=seal_75cd0b2d
DRUVAN_STANDBY_TEAM=tamael

Ticket: Address autocomplete widget drops suggestions on fast typing

Welcome aboard. The Lumenfield checkout form uses our Pinmarker autocomplete widget. When a user types quickly, the debounce handler cancels in-flight requests but also clears the suggestion list, leaving the dropdown empty until the next keystroke. Repro: type a street name in under 400ms on the staging kiosk. Expected: last valid suggestions remain visible. Fix likely lives in the request-cancellation branch. The failing build's token is recorded below for reference.

pipeline stamp: htk31_f769b577b3028a4e9958e5bb8d1259a

Step 4: Migrating to per-tenant rate quotas in Quillgate 3.x. Plugin authors must stop reading the legacy global throttle value; it is ignored after this release. Instead, query the tenant quota endpoint at startup and cache the response for no longer than five minutes, since quotas can be adjusted by operators at any time. Ensure your backoff logic respects the quota-exceeded response code rather than retrying immediately. For reference during testing, the default sandbox quota configuration is shown below.

settings of tagef-bawif:
DRUIX_HOST=druix.zemvarlabs.internal
DRUIX_PORT=8000

TURN-208: Gatevale turnstile counters at the Merrow Field pilot double-count when a rotation reverses mid-cycle. Attendance totals drift roughly 2% high per event. The debounce window fix is implemented, reviewed by Ilsa, and soak-tested across two simulated match days without drift. Ready for your cut; the candidate build is identified below.

trace token, tagag-tafog: htk6_5ed18c